We're recruiting confident, professional individuals to join our team as Environmental Enforcement Officers. This is a front-line, on-the-ground role where you'll spend your working day on foot patrol, identifying environmental offences and issuing Fixed Penalty Notices (FPNs) to members of the public.,

  • Starting your day by heading out on foot patrol across busy town centres, high-footfall areas and residential streets
  • Observing public behaviour and identifying offences such as littering, dog fouling and fly-tipping
  • Approaching offenders confidently and professionally to explain the offence and issue Fixed Penalty Notices
  • Educating members of the public on their environmental responsibilities
  • Accurately recording evidence, statements and reports using provided systems
  • Working independently while remaining supported by a wider enforcement team and management
  • You'll be outdoors for most of your shift and regularly engaging with the public, so confidence, resilience and professionalism are key.

    This role is ideal for someone who enjoys being outdoors, working independently, and making a visible difference to local communities.,

    Waste Investigations Support & Enforcement (WISE) works in partnership with Local Authorities across the UK to tackle environmental crime, including littering, fly-tipping, dog fouling and duty of care offences. Using industry expertise, trained officers and modern technology, we deliver visible, fair and effective enforcement that helps keep boroughs clean and safe.
